After the group defeated the Stag Lord, I didn't give them a quest XP bonus; I just gave them XP for the Stag Lord himself and the GP reward. They also got XP for turning in his body to Nettles and completing that part of the quest.
Since that was the completion of the book, I did "adjust" the final XP awarded to put the party just over what was required to put them at level 4, so they could level up and begin the second book at that point. It might be a consideration for you if you want to go that route (bearing in mind that they get XP bonuses right in the beginning of book 2 for founding and increasing their city -- they could level off that as well if preferred.)
